WebJul 15, 2024 · 4 Rule 4512(c) defines “institutional account” as the account of: (1) a bank, savings and loan association, insurance company or registered investment … WebJun 19, 2024 · FINRA Rule 4512(c)(3) defines the term “institutional account” to include natural persons with assets of at least $50 million. A high net-worth individual’s treatment as “institutional” excludes their account from, among other things, FINRA’s “customer-specific” suitability review requirements.
